Output d6b509b7a83e0218f5212710c395a75d030848f6d130bf56b6cd732def0ef8f4:2

value
2186280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43b42efe908e84f59fda9e1d9282d2939a1a7f7c OP_EQUALVERIFY OP_CHECKSIG
address
17Az8E9arBTAeWVGW7DxKChHe7ohw6eXoj
transaction
d6b509b7a83e0218f5212710c395a75d030848f6d130bf56b6cd732def0ef8f4
confirmations
681294
spent
true